Finance Review — Q3 Marketing Budget. Marketing spend at Vellmark Industries reduced 18% effective next month. Sponsorships for the Hartlow trade fair cancelled; digital campaigns for the Ondra product line halved. Savings redirected to working capital. Department heads must submit revised spend plans by Friday. Context for this decision follows below.

confidential, kagup-bafog: Fraaxax Group is in early talks to buy Soroxox Group for about $343.8 million. The Olidor launch date is June 14, and nothing goes to the press before then. Legal wants the Aldmirek Logistics term sheet signed before July 23.

Handover — Largediff viewer

Welcome aboard. The viewer chunks files over 50 MB and streams hunks lazily; the myers fallback kicks in only below that threshold. Known issue: syntax highlighting times out on minified bundles — there's a skip list, add extensions there rather than raising the timeout. Tests live under `viewer/spec`. Deploys go through Brindlewood CI, staging first. The config the staging instance currently runs with is below.

deployment values, tafof-taduf:
pelius:
  pin: 6508
  tenant: praiel
  seal: seal_4e33a2f4
  metrics_host: metrics.pelius.plorvagrid.corp
  standby_team: druix
  escalation: juldor-norius
  nonce: 5db598

Ticket: Undo eats two steps in Glyphboard

Hey, welcome aboard! In the diagram editor, hitting undo after resizing a shape sometimes reverts both the resize and the previous move — redo only brings one back. Looks like the history stack merges events that land within 200ms. Repro is easiest with a trackpad. The build where I saw this is noted below.

pipeline stamp: htk9_ce63042d9

## Further Reading

This section covers only the basics of the Parcelwise webhook. Delivery events fire when a scanned parcel changes status, and retries follow an exponential backoff for up to six hours. Signature verification is mandatory; unsigned payloads are dropped silently, which is the most common cause of "missing event" tickets. For the complete event catalog, retry schedule, and troubleshooting checklist, see the internal reference page.

operations page: https://confluence.tolvaqsys.corp/spaces/pages/pages/6e787158f507